Make sure your workout shoes are comfortable. You want to enable yourself to really push your body, and having sore feet or even hurting yourself by wearing improper shoes is no way to accomplish that. The shoes need not be pricey; just be certain to try them on so that you know they fit properly.

Learn to decipher food labels. Fat-free foods are not always healthy, for example. It might have a lot of calories and a high sugar content, which you should avoid. Be sure to read the whole label to know what your food contains.

A major component of successful weight loss is watching your portion sizes. For example, an appropriate portion of meat should only be about 3 ounces, or roughly, the same size as your palm. It’s been proven that people who pay attention to what they’re eating tend to weight less.
